The sold-out Reimagine the River conference, held Wednesday at The Redd on Salmon Street in Portland, brought together civic, tribal, nonprofit and business leaders to discuss the regionβs connection to the Willamette River. The daylong event, hosted by the 1803 Fund, EcoTrust and the Willamette Falls Trust, featured speakers discussing the commercial, recreational and transportation opportunities along the river, from Oregon City to North Portland.
